A Secret

They tease
And wonder
Why I am smiling so
And humming happy tunes under my breath
And why the strut's back in my walk...
But I won't tell them
Because if I do
Everyone would want
A little piece of this heaven too.
So I'll just keep right on smiling
And struting
And humming happy tunes under my breath
And keeping you a secret all to myself!
